<p>I&#8217;m going to do a short series about the state of the birds, this information is borrowed from the State of the Birds Report for 2009. Today&#8217;s discussion is about the birds of the Aridlands. The aridlands are the major deserts of North America, such as the Mojave and Sonoran Desert. They are characterized by low annual rainfall. Pretty much dry, desert-like areas with lots of scrub.</p>
<p><strong>The Facts:</strong></p>
<ul>
<li>More than 80 nesting species, many very unique to the area<span style="font-family:Times New Roman;font-size:12pt;"><br />
</span></li>
<li>More than 3/4 of the species are declining in the aridlands</li>
<li>Habitat loss, habitat degradation, invasive species and climate change all contribute to the decline of species</li>
<li>39% are of conservation concern</li>
<li>10 species are listed as endangered or threatened</li>
<li>There has been steady decline of 17 of the 30 obligate species over the past 40 years</li>
</ul>

<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><p><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-45" title="win_logo" src="http://jtromba621.wordpress.com/files/2009/09/win_logo.png" alt="win_logo" width="120" height="34" />     In order to find out what people really thought about Microsoft Vista, Microsoft conducted an experiment disguising Vista under the code name of Mojave and introduced it as the next operating system.  Their primary results concluded that 94% of respondents rate Mojave higher than what they initially rated Vista before the demo.  0% of the respondents rated Mojave lower than what they initially rated Vista before the demo.  On a scale from 1-10, the results coming from 140 people, 4.4 was the average pre-demo score for Windows Vista.  8.5 was the average post-demo score for the codenamed Windows Mojave.  Demos showed to the participants included security, compatibility, organization, Windows Media Center, file backup and gadgets.  <a href="http://www.microsoft.com/windows/mojave-experiment/#">http://www.microsoft.com/windows/mojave-experiment/#</a></p>
<p>     Microsoft conducted this experiment because they believed that the trouble people were having with Vista was really all in their head.  But according to many IT Managers, that isn’t so.  They cited the reasons for not wanting to upgrade to Vista due to it’s resource requirements, intrusive security features and lack of compatibility with older software.  Many people questioned the fact that users were only able to watch Vista, but not actually interact with it.  I believe if the participants were allowed to actually use it and not just watch it, the post-demo score would not have jumped so high.  When I bought a new desktop computer in January 2008, Microsoft Vista was the operating system.  I do not care for it at all.  I still prefer Windows XP over Vista.  <a href="http://www.informationweek.com/news/windows/operatingsystems/showArticle.jhtml?articleID=209800457">http://www.informationweek.com/news/windows/operatingsystems/showArticle.jhtml?articleID=209800457</a></p>
<p>     The marketing aspects of the Mojave Experiment clearly backfired on Microsoft.  The most obvious reason being that they think consumers are stupid.  They also make the participants of the experiment look foolish, and who likes to feel that way?  Nobody.  Blaming the users of Vista for having problems with the operating software isn’t a great strategy to get more people to buy Vista either.  <a href="http://www.microsoft-watch.com/content/marketing/why_the_mojave_experiment_fails.html">http://www.microsoft-watch.com/content/marketing/why_the_mojave_experiment_fails.html</a></p>

<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><p>Mojave anyone? When Microsoft polled 140 people that received a special new preview of Window&#8217;s latest operating system called &#8220;Mojave&#8221;, 94% initially gave it a higher rating that Window&#8217;s most recent operating system entitled Windows Vista. The only problem with this seeming simple &#8220;experiment&#8221; is that Windows Mojave is in actuality Windows Vista. The good people at Microsoft told 140 selected participants that Mojave was the latest greatest. As a result, the 140 people who reviewed the program gave it an average score of 8.5 out of 10. In contrast, those same people gave an average score of 4.4 to Windows Vista. So how could the same 140 people have radically different opinions about the exact same program with the exact same features (http://www.microsoft.com/windows/mojave-experiment/#)? It&#8217;s all about the marketing.</p>
<p>Our society has become brainwashed into thinking that whatever product is the newest technological wonder is automatically the best product available. In fact, as this &#8220;experiment&#8221; exposes, the difference between the old product and the new product can be nothing at all. Perception in the world of consumer electronics is everything. This presents a tremendous challenge for people at Microsoft and other software development companies. Once software is released, the clock begins ticking for when that particular product is considered by the public to be outdated. Consumers are constantly looking toward the next big thing, even when the next big thing is right in front of them. It has stopped becoming about what software can do for you and more about whether this is the newest software available. In an article by Jason Chen of Gizmodo.com, the author astutely points out that while the experiment fools people unfamiliar with Vista, it would not fool those who are used to Vista or who are typically using technology on a daily basis on high levels (http://gizmodo.com/5030561/microsofts-mojave-bait+and+switch-vista-experiment-video). But that is not the point of the experiment. Microsoft, like all companies in the software market, is constantly looking at how they can expand their market share, not please those who are already tech-savvy. Paul Miller, a blogger at Engadget.com, claims that this &#8220;slick sales presentation&#8221; does not prove anything (http://www.engadget.com/2008/07/29/mojave-experiment-goes-live-doesnt-fail-to-annoy/). Again, I totally disagree. I think it proves that when it comes to software, you are better off releasing the same product twice and renaming it than you are spending millions in development for a product no one will appreciate.</p>

<p>Today’s Daily Dose track ‘For a While’ comes to you from Vancouver band Mojave’s second album <em>Crow’s Funeral</em>. Mojave are lead singer/guitarist LJ and guitarist/sometimes singer Paul. They are an elusive pair, no last names given, but after hearing their album you could feel as if you know them, such are the depths to which they plunge into their emotions and experiences.</p>
<p>Part folkish-rock, part symphonic and entirely emotive, the album is a haunting mix of urgent, pleading vocals, delicate guitars and rich, warm strings.</p>
<p>The instrumentation is pleasingly varied, moving from epic, almost operatic numbers full of strings like this Daily Dose track, to banjo-led ballads (the title track), with some theramin thrown in for colour on ‘Wake Up’. The lyrics are consistently poignant, and delivered so beautifully and tentatively that the emotional feel of each song is truly compelling.</p>
<p>There is a sense of vulnerability on this record that makes you feel as if you’ve become privy to someone’s innermost thoughts, and an honesty that makes it captivating if not a tiny bit unnerving. However, the dark secrets of this album are cut through in the middle by ‘California’, a hopeful and uplifting track that lends some sunshine to an otherwise heartwrenching record.</p>
<p><em>Crow’s Funeral</em> is a dark, resounding album full of many different layers, both musically and emotionally, which gives a glimpse into the lives of its composers that can catch you off guard; a rare feat, and a beautiful one.</p>

<p>See that striped abdomen in the center?  That&#8217;s a female <em>Ashmeadiella opuntiae</em> (Megachilidae), a pollen specialist (oligolege) on plants in the cactus family (Cactaceae), building her nest in a hole in the tip of one of those very cacti, a buckhorn cholla (<em>Opuntia acanthocarpa</em>).  It was so special to see this <em>A. opuntiae</em> making her home sweet home in her host plant &#8212; a rare sight.</p>

<p><strong>NATURAL HISTORY DESCRIPTION</strong></p>
<p><strong>Date/Time:</strong> 2:00 PM on 8 June 2006</p>
<p><strong>Location: </strong>Near the intersection of Cedar Canyon Road and Ivanpah Road in Lanfair Valley in the Mojave National Preserve, San Bernardino Co., California, USA.</p>
<p><strong>Observation:</strong> I observed a female <em>Ashmeadiella opuntiae</em> (Megachilidae) entering and leaving a hole in the tip of a branch of <em>Opuntia acanthocarpa</em> (Cactaceae).  The location of the hole was in the stem tip tissue from which the previous year&#8217;s ripe fruit had fallen away.  The hole appeared to have been opened by a source other than the bee.  The bee appeared to be constructing a nest within the hole; she would enter and remain half-submerged in the hole, with her abdomen protruding, as she worked inside.  When the bee saw that she was being observed and photographed, she fully entered the hole and turned around to face me, hidden and protected in her nest.  During the observation period (~10 minutes), she entered and emerged from the hole/nest multiple times.</p>

<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><p><a href="http://earth2tech.wordpress.com/files/2009/08/quercustrust_logo.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-39223" title="quercustrust_logo" src="http://earth2tech.wordpress.com/files/2009/08/quercustrust_logo.jpg" alt="quercustrust_logo" width="200" height="130" /></a>Pour enough cash into greentech startups and <a href="http://www.sfgate.com/cgi-bin/article.cgi?file=/chronicle/archive/2004/11/07/BAGN19MGV11.DTL">environmental efforts</a>, and sooner or later a couple of your investments might cross paths &#8212; especially in a time when large-scale solar projects planned for the Mojave Desert are coming under fire from environmental groups concerned about desert species and habitats.</p>
<p>For venture capitalist David Gelbaum, it&#8217;s sooner: The former hedge fund and mathematician&#8217;s firm, Quercus Trust, is one of at least six major backers for <a href="http://esolar.com/">eSolar</a>, a solar thermal developer that won praise from the non-profit Wildlands Conservancy last week for siting its latest project &#8212; the <a href="http://earth2tech.com/2009/08/05/live-esolar-flips-the-switch-on-first-solar-power-tower-in-u-s/">5 MW Sierra SunTower</a> &#8212; on &#8220;disturbed lands,&#8221; rather than &#8220;pristine California desert.&#8221; Director David Myers summed up his stance like so: &#8220;We can&#8217;t say enough great things about eSolar.&#8221;<br />
<!--more--></p>
<p>That works out nicely for Gelbaum, because guess who sits on the Conservancy&#8217;s board and has become the group&#8217;s biggest backer? None other than the VC himself, according to <a href="http://greenwombat.blogs.fortune.cnn.com/2009/08/14/wildlands-conservancys-solar-connection/">Green Wombat</a>.</p>
<p>It should be said that the Wildlands Conservancy has provided one of the louder voices of support for Sen. Dianne Feinstein&#8217;s proposal to ban renewable energy projects on vast swaths of the Mojave, as <a href="http://greeninc.blogs.nytimes.com/tag/wildlands-conservancy/">NYT&#8217;s Green Inc. noted recently</a>. So while it&#8217;s unlikely that Myers showed up at eSolar&#8217;s SunTower event last week simply because of Gelbaum&#8217;s interest, the desert development issue has positioned the Conservancy in staunch opposition to some of eSolar&#8217;s potential competitors. For example, <a href="http://www.pe.com/localnews/sbcounty/stories/PE_News_Local_S_solar21.3cf231d.html">Myers has called</a> solar thermal startup BrightSource Energy&#8217;s planned 500 MW project in the Mojave, which is among those that would be halted under Feinstein&#8217;s legislation, &#8220;devastating.&#8221;</p>
<p>As for Gelbaum, it makes sense for a millionaire environmentalist to back both green advocacy work and alternative energy ventures. With any luck, his investments will continue to get along.</p>
